Context and Background: The Educators Who Shaped a Star

Zendaya was born in Oakland, California, in 1996, raised by a mother of German and Scottish descent and an African American father. Claire Stoermer spent decades working as a teacher and served as the house manager at the historic California Shakespeare Theater in Orinda, California. This theatrical connection exposed Zendaya to the performing arts at an exceptionally young age, where she spent hours watching plays and helping backstage.

Kazembe Ajamu Coleman also worked as a teacher before transitioning into a central managerial and protective role as his daughter's career accelerated. The dynamic between Stoermer and Coleman provided a stable foundation, emphasizing academic discipline, self-worth, and cultural awareness long before Zendaya landed her breakout roles on Disney Channel. Following their divorce, both parents maintained a united front, frequently traveling with her to international film premieres and fashion events.
